Analysis

The most recent figure for annual value added and its components by economic activity in United States is 117.81 Index,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 28 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.6% on the previous year and up 20.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, annual value added and its components by economic activity in United States peaked at 117.81 Index in 2024 and was at its lowest, 65.43 Index, in 1998.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 28 years of available data.

This table presents gross value added by economic activity based on detailed breakdowns of Revision 4 of the International Standard Industrial Classification of All Economic Activities (ISIC). The table also presents detailed ISIC data for output, intermediate consumption and consumption of fixed capital (depreciation), as well as for components of gross value added (GVA) such as wages and salaries and net operating surplus (business profits) and mixed income (profits of the self-employed). These can be selected using the ‘Transaction filter’. The presentation is on a country-by-country basis. Users are recommended to select one country (or area) at a time in the ‘Reference area’ filter. Data is presented for each country in national currency as well as in euros for the European Union and the euro area. Data is presented in current prices (default view), but for some items it is possible to select chain linked volume and other price measures using the ‘Price base’ filter.
